==== Byzantine Empire ==== * [[July 29]] – [[Sack of Thessalonica (904)|Sack of Thessalonica]]: A Muslim fleet, led by the Greek renegade [[Leo of Tripoli]], appears outside [[Thessaloniki|Thessalonica]] and begins its attack after a short and silent inspection of the fortification of the city. After attacks from the sea for two days, the [[Saracens]] are able to storm the city walls, overcome the Thessalonians' resistance and capture the city. The sacking continues for a full week, before the raiders depart for their base in the [[Levant]]. Having freed 4,000 Muslim prisoners and captured 60 ships, gaining a large loot, they carry off 22,000 men and women as slaves.<ref>Faith and Sword: A short history of Christian-Muslim conflict by Alan G. Jamieson, p. 32.</ref> * [[Arab–Byzantine wars|Arab–Byzantine War]]: The [[Byzantine Empire|Byzantines]] under [[Andronikos Doukas (general under Leo VI)|Andronikos Doukas]], along with [[Eustathios Argyros (general under Leo VI)|Eustathios Argyros]], campaign against the [[Abbasid Caliphate|Abbasids]] and defeat the Muslim [[garrison]]s of [[Mopsuestia]] and [[Tarsus, Mersin|Tarsus]], near [[Kahramanmaraş|Marash]] (modern [[Turkey]]). * Emperor [[Leo VI the Wise|Leo VI]] ('''the Wise''') is forced to sign a [[peace treaty]] with [[Simeon I of Bulgaria|Simeon I]], ruler (''[[knyaz]]'') of the [[First Bulgarian Empire|Bulgarian Empire]]. All [[Slavs|Slavic]]-inhabited lands of [[Macedonia (region)|Macedonia]] and southern [[Albania]] are ceded to the Bulgarians.
